web-dev-qa-db-ja.com

WAMPとXAMPPの長所/短所 - ローカルテストサーバーを実行するためのもの

2つのうちどちらを選択するかを決定するのに役立つことができる主な長所/短所は何ですか。

シモンズ:私は今 スタックオーバーフローがそれについて議論しているのを見ます

36
Tal Galili

最大の違い - WAMPはWindows上で動作し、XAMPPはマルチプラットフォームです。それ以外は個人的な好みの問題です。どちらもApache-MySQL-PHP環境を提供し、どちらのシステムでもほぼ同じ動作をします。

23
EAMann
  1. XAMPPはNOTクロスプラットフォームです。 Windows用、Linux用、Mac用、Solaris用のXAMPPがありますが、各パックにはさまざまなソフトウェアが含まれており、さまざまなパフォーマンスで異なる動作をします(クロスプラットフォームとは、まったく同じソフトウェアを使用して実行される) Azureusのように、異なるプラットフォームでも同じように使えます。

  2. Windows用のXAMPPは肥大化しています。メールサーバー、FTPサーバー、アクセラレータ、web-dav、SSLはそのまま使えます。これは厳密には初級レベルのパッケージではありませんが、一般的にはすべてのインストールがはるかに簡単になります。それを超えて、どんなカスタマイズも他の既製のスタックと同じ努力を必要とします。あなたがあなた自身の箱にインストールするなら、あなたはおそらくFTPサーバーを必要としないでしょう、あなたは?

  3. WAMPはもっと軽い(ほとんどが基本)。それ以外にも、phpMyAdmin、SQLite、xdebugといった2つのツールがあります。 SSLが必要ですか?設定する必要があります。メールサーバーにアクセスしたいですか?自分でインストールする必要があります。 FTP?同上。

  4. WAMPは(名前が言うように)Windows(64/32ビット)でonlyを実行します。

Windows上のローカルマシンでは、WAMPが最適な方法です。軽く、滑らかで、インストール後の設定は簡単です。 Windows用のXAMPPは、64ビットインストールの問題から競合他社ほどではありません(当然:インストールするためのより多くのソフトウェア、そして32/64ビットの間で余分なソフトウェアの各部分を管理する必要があります)。

30
Andrew

WAMPは、Windows、Apache、MySQL、およびPHPを意味する頭字語です。

XAMPP、WampServer(単に "WAMP"と呼んでいるもの)、 Wamp-Developer Pro (市販のソフトウェア)、その他のWAMP "ディストリビューション"などがあります。

Windows用のXAMPPは、もう1つのWAMPディストリビューションです。

7
rightstuff

XAMPPはメールサーバやFTPサーバなどを持っているので肥大しているという異議はあなたが何を必要としているかを尋ねることによって答えられるかもしれません。あなたがそれらのアイテムの大部分または全部を必要とするならば、それはあなたのための完全なXAMPPです。 PHPやMySQLを含むWebページを開発するだけの場合は、XAMPP Liteを使用してください。異なる時に、私は両方とも非常に便利であるとわかりました。私は特にUSBフラッシュドライブのどちらでも動くことができるのが好きです。

そのフラッシュドライブにNetBeansを追加できたら….

3
Uncle Ed

WAMPはXAMPPよりも実行に多くのメモリを使用します。

2
joey

私はXAMPPを使用してきましたが、1つの注目すべき例外はありますが、一般的にはそれに満足しています。 XAMPPを使用している場合、サイトを読み込むのがいつも私にとって苦痛なほど遅くなっていました。それがWAMPに当てはまるかどうかはわかりませんが、検討する価値があります。

2

厳密に質問に答えるのではありませんが、パッケージがどのように連携するのかを知りたい場合は、手動でインストールして構成することをお勧めします。私は このチュートリアル をガイドラインとして使用しています。これは詳細な説明であり、すべてを実行中で互いに話し合うのに役立ちます。もう少し手間がかかりますが、はるかに柔軟性があり、実際には重要な構成について学習します。

2
Grant Palin

記載されていないWAMPの利点を追加したいのですが。

WAMPでは、phpの異なるバージョン間で簡単に切り替えることを可能にする拡張機能*をインストールすることができます。 WordPressの最小要件はphp 5.2.4であり、それを使用しているサーバー上で動作することが保証されているので、WordPressと完全に互換性があるためにプラグインはphpのそのバージョンで動作する必要があります。 php 5.3以降には、名前空間など、5.2.4にはない機能がたくさんあります。

あなたがWordPress開発者であり、あなたのプラグイン、ウィジェット、またはテーマを完全に互換性があり、どのWordPressインストールでも実行したい場合は、php 5.2.4で環境設定をすることが役に立ちます。 XAMPPはそれをする簡単な方法を提供しません。

* WAMPサーバの新しいバージョンはもはや拡張をサポートしていないことに注意すべきです。ただし、WAMPサーバー2.2(32ビット)はSourceForgeで入手可能で、それらをサポートしています。 php 5.2.4をインストールするための正しいバージョンのApacheもあります。

2
RaneWrites

WAMPに _ ssl _ を実装すると、XAMPPでは非常に簡単でしたが、もっと面倒なことに気付きました(ようやく処理できずに諦めました)。

それ以外は、 Linux Windows の両方のプラットフォームを使用していて快適です。もちろん、私はずっとずっと長い間XAMPPを使ってきました。

1
Esobje

xamppはwamp(フランスの開発者)より遅いです。両方あります。

1
Alvin